What is the cheapest month to fly to Edinburgh?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Edinburgh,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ights to Edinburgh is March, where tickets cost £52 on average for one-way fl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and August, where the average cost of tickets from Poland is £184 and £155 respectively. For return trips, the best month to travel is January with an average price of £68.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Edinburgh?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Edinburgh,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 58 days before departure.

  • How far is Edinburgh Turnhouse Airport from central Edinburgh?

    The distance between Edinburgh Turnhouse Airport and the city centre of Edinburgh is 7 miles.

  • What is the name of Edinburgh’s airport?

    All flights to Edinburgh land at Edinburgh Turnhouse Airport. The airport code is EDI,and it can also be referred to as Edinburgh, Edinburgh Turnhouse, or Turnhouse.
